Sole Spirit (14:40 Carlisle)
John Pentin; Sports journalist at BettingTips4You
Rationale: Carlisle’s six-furlong Class 5 handicap promises to be an intriguing opening leg for our Lucky 15, and Sole Spirit looks the one with the most upside. The three-year-old has already demonstrated real potential by stringing together two wins earlier this campaign, both at Doncaster and Thirsk. Those successes came at today’s distance, showing he has the speed and strength to handle the task at hand.

What makes Sole Spirit especially appealing is the way he dealt with a significant rise in the weights for his second success. Carrying an extra 7lb, he still showed enough acceleration to settle matters against credible opposition, drawing clear of the runner-up with authority. This sort of progression signals a horse still very much on an upward curve.
The fact he now tackles Carlisle for a trainer with a proven record in this race only enhances his claims. Bryan Smart’s yard have lifted this very contest three times since 2016, including last season, which adds historical confidence. Given that profile, Sole Spirit looks a solid choice to continue his winning run and provide a strong starting point for the accumulator.

Alphonse Le Grande (16:10 York)
Gram Dodd; Sports journalist at BettingTips4You
Rationale: The third leg of our Lucky 15 centres on York’s Stayers’ Handicap, and Alphonse Le Grande looks primed to make amends after a luckless run at Royal Ascot. A proven performer in big-field staying handicaps, he captured major prizes last season, including the Chester Cup consolation and the Northumberland Plate consolation before crowning his campaign with a gutsy win in the Cesarewitch.
This season he shaped as though needing the run when reappearing at the Curragh, but he left that effort behind at Royal Ascot. On that occasion, he travelled smoothly but met trouble in running early in the straight, losing valuable momentum. Despite that, he rallied impressively to finish within striking distance of the principals, giving every indication he retains his old ability.
With only two runs under his belt so far this year, he remains relatively fresh and still looks fairly handicapped. His proven stamina over extreme trips and his ability to dig deep under pressure make him a standout choice in this competitive field. York’s long straight provides the perfect stage for his relentless finishing kick, and if granted a clearer passage, he could well assert late.
Valsharah (20:20 Kempton)
Steve Harrington; Sports journalist at BettingTips4You
Rationale: The final selection in today’s Lucky 15 comes at Kempton, where Valsharah looks poised to strike after a highly encouraging effort last time out. Upped to seven furlongs, he tried to dictate matters from the front but was collared by Breakdancer, who appeared a cut above on the day. Importantly, Valsharah stuck on gamely to finish second, pulling well clear of the remainder.
That effort confirmed he is capable of performing to a level required to win in this grade. Returning now to the same course and distance, conditions look tailor-made for another bold bid. With valuable track experience under his belt, he should be sharper tactically and may find this assignment less demanding without a rival of Breakdancer’s calibre in opposition.
His natural early pace is a big weapon at Kempton, where prominent runners often gain an advantage. If he can conserve a little more for the closing stages, the balance of his profile suggests he has what it takes to land this race. With his progression clear to see, Valsharah represents an excellent way to close the Lucky 15 on a high.
